A 35-year-old man was allegedly shot dead by two unidentified bike-borne persons in Sangvi area of Pimpri Chinchwad in Pune district on Wednesday evening, police said.
The incident occurred when the victim, Deepak Kadam, was standing in front of a shop.
''After the incident, he was rushed to the hospital but declared dead on arrival,'' he said.
We suspect that the attack was a fallout of an old enmity. A search for the shooters is on, said a police officer.
He said the slain man had an attempt to murder case pending against him.
